I was probably already pre-biased in his favour because he is Greek and I used to live in Greece. However apart from Mr Polyzois (Mr Many Lives in English) being a generally charming and well-informed bloke, the best bit about his care was that having followed his suggestions around specific exercise, not drinking alcohol and not smoking, a terrible fracture to my right humerus healed itself and this meant that I did not, in the end, have to undergo any operations, pins, plates, being in pain for weeks etc. I am sure this saved the NHS a load of money, Mr Polyzois a load of precious time, plus I got the encouragement I needed to start going to the gym and swimming instead of sitting around waiting for an anesthetist etc. and then being unable to do anything requiring right arm for probably weeks. Non-operational treatment is the way forward if it can be reasonably justified. But you need to do what he suggests. I did, and now I pretty much have full movement in right arm. The only thing I can't do yet is front crawl - yet.
